Q4

What should I do if my suspension makes noise or feels unstable?

If your suspension makes noise or feels unstable, check for loose bolts, worn bushings, or damaged components. Inspect shocks and springs for leaks or sagging. Tighten or replace parts as needed. If the issue persists, consult a professional mechanic for a thorough diagnosis. Regular maintenance can prevent many common suspension problems.
